This is another point where there is a real choice between Declude 
and IMGateAV.  IMGate does per domain relaying, so IMgate can relay 
domain traffic
to the IMGateAV for scanning and IMGateAV relays to Imail, or IMGate 
can bypass IMGateAV and relay directly to Imail.

Per domain scanning is useful if you want to charge for AV scanning. 
We are charging about US$45/month per 200 megabytes of SMTP traffic 
(about 10K msgs @ 20 Kbytes/msg), unlimited mailboxes, unlimited 
domains. ie, it's a per client charge, even if the client has 10 
domains, we count that client's total SMTP traffic through IMGateAV 
with the maillog summarizer/stats that comes with IMGate.
